Our Brother the Native – Tooth and Claws

Freak-experimental-folk. I don’t like agreeing with distribution copy but they do sound exactly like the kid brothers of Cocorosie and Animal Collective – noisier, free-flowing, circuit-bent campfire songs. Amazing how much vocals sound like cocorosie given that they’re boys, though they are 16, 16, and 18. No FCC. Picks 6, 7, 12
